Water damage can strike unexpectedly, leading to significant financial burdens for homeowners and businesses alike. Understanding the prices related to water damage repair is essential for successfully managing a property’s situation. This understanding might help in budgeting and executing swift actions to attenuate damage and associated costs.


The preliminary cost typically begins with assessing the extent of the damage. A professional inspection is often beneficial, as untrained eyes may miss underlying issues. This inspection can range in price, relying on the property measurement and the severity of the damage. Homeowners can also select to conduct their very own preliminary assessments, but this danger may lead to overlooking severe issues, resulting in larger costs later on.

Once the extent of harm is assessed, immediate action is often needed. Water extraction is among the first steps, usually performed by professionals equipped with specialized tools. This process can be costly, especially if the damage covers a big space or entails important water levels. Quick removal is important to stop mold progress and structural deterioration, thus saving additional bills down the line.

Drying out the affected areas can take time and sometimes involves rental equipment like dehumidifiers and fans. Professional services may make the most of industrial-grade tools to expedite the drying process. Renting or buying this equipment can significantly ramp up prices, contributing to the general expenditure through the repair section.

Should mold develop from lingering moisture, remediation can present a hefty monetary burden. Mold removal typically requires specialised professionals, as it is not merely about cleaning up. The affected supplies may also have to be disposed of and replaced, including further expenses. Ignoring this could lead to well being risks and prolonged property damage, making it an essential facet of water damage repair.

Home insurance can present some relief regarding water damage repair prices, depending on the particular policy phrases. Promptly reporting the incident to insurance suppliers is important. However, it is crucial to know that not all cases of water damage are coated, significantly those stemming from lack of maintenance or gradual wear.

How does the cause for water damage affect repair costs?undefinedFactors similar to the trigger of the water damage (e.g., flooding, leaks, or plumbing issues) significantly influence repair costs. For instance, flooding usually requires intensive cleanup and restoration, resulting in greater costs compared to a minor leak.


Are there additional costs in addition to the preliminary repair?undefinedYes, further costs may include momentary relocation, repairs to structural damage, mold remediation, and ongoing upkeep to stop future damage.

Does home-owner's insurance cover water damage repair costs?undefinedCoverage is dependent upon the coverage. Most commonplace insurance policies cowl sudden and accidental water damage, but gradual damage or flooding will not be covered. It's essential to review your policy details.


How can I reduce the prices of water damage repairs?undefinedTo decrease prices, tackle leaks or issues immediately, use a professional for early assessment, and contemplate preventive measures. This may help mitigate intensive damage and decrease general repair expenses.


What ought to I count on in the company website course of the water damage repair process?undefinedExpect a multi-step process that features evaluation, water extraction, drying, cleansing, and repairs. A skilled will guide you thru every part and provide transparency on costs and timelines.


Are DIY repairs price it for water damage?undefinedWhile DIY repairs can save on labor prices, it might lead to extra important long-term points if not done see page correctly. Hiring professionals is commonly a safer and more practical selection for extensive damage.

How long does the water damage repair process usually take?undefinedDepending on damage severity, repairs can take anywhere from a couple of days to a number of weeks. Immediate action often accelerates the timeline as it prevents additional issues, corresponding to mold development.


What are the indicators that water damage could be more costly than initially expected?undefinedSigns like persistent odors, visible mold development, swollen partitions, or structural instability point out extra severe issues that would lead to larger repair prices. Early inspection is crucial.
